"This engaging, beautifully illustrated book brings together a selection of highlights from the National Trust's vast collection. Arranged chronologically, starting with Roman sculpture and ending with 20th-century design, it focuses on museum-quality objects as well as important examples of decorative arts, furniture, textiles and objects with fascinating stories. The highlights - from Cardinal Wolsey's purse to Rodin's bust of George Bernard Shaw - are illustrated with exquisite photography and accompanied by illuminating captions. The book also includes a timeline of key moments in the Trust's history"--
